Slapy is a village located in the Central Bohemian Region of Czechia, specifically at the coordinates 49.81531, 14.39612. It is situated approximately 30 kilometers south of Prague, making it accessible for visitors from the capital. The village lies within the timezone of Europe/Prague.
Slapy is well-known for its picturesque surroundings, particularly the Slapy Reservoir, which is a popular destination for water sports, fishing, and recreational activities. The reservoir attracts both locals and tourists seeking outdoor activities and relaxation by the water. The region’s natural beauty and proximity to Prague contribute to its significance as a weekend getaway and a serene retreat for those looking to escape the city.

Attractions and Activities in Slapy
Slapy is a small village in the Central Bohemian Region of Czechia, situated along the banks of the Slapy Reservoir. This area is primarily known for its stunning natural landscapes and recreational opportunities, making it a popular destination for outdoor enthusiasts. The reservoir itself is a significant feature, offering activities such as boating, fishing, and swimming, which attract visitors during the warmer months.
The region around Slapy is characterized by rolling hills and dense forests, providing a picturesque backdrop for hiking and cycling. The nearby villages and towns contribute to the local charm, showcasing traditional Czech architecture and culture. While Slapy may not be a bustling urban center, its tranquil environment and natural beauty make it an appealing retreat for those looking to escape city life.
The area is ideal for family outings and weekend getaways, promoting a lifestyle that embraces nature and outdoor recreation.
Practical Information for Visitors
Slapy is situated about 30 kilometers from Prague, making it accessible via various transport options. The nearest major airport is Václav Havel Airport in Prague, where you can rent a car or take a shuttle to Slapy. Public transportation options include buses from Prague, which run regularly and offer a scenic route.
If you prefer trains, the nearest train station is in Štěchovice, from which you can take a bus or taxi to Slapy. The weather in Slapy is characterized by a temperate climate with warm summers and cold winters. Summer temperatures can reach up to 30°C, making it ideal for outdoor activities like swimming and hiking.
The best time to visit is during the late spring to early fall, from May to September, when the weather is pleasant for exploring the natural beauty of the area.
